  • Money maker: Traffic camera at Bank Junction makes £15m in fines in three years

    May 20, 2022

    The traffic camera at Bank Junction has made £15.2m in fines between 2018 and 2021. According to a FOI request by Bloomberg News to the City of London Corporation, in 2021 fines at the junction amounted to £3.2m – 40 per cent of all penalties levied in the City during the year.   • City of London backs plans to ‘design out suicide’ from skyscrapers

    April 29, 2022

    Plans to “design out suicide” from the Square Mile’s skyscrapers have been approved by the City of London. The Corporation’s planning committee backed advice in a paper about preventing deaths in high rise buildings, using methods which designers should take on.
